J.L. Crosswhite and I had a chat about her books, specifically her romantic suspense series–the Hometown Heroes and the In the Shadows series both!

We also digressed and talked about readership, publishing, and the pros and cons of traditional and indie publishing. All with tons of laughter!

While Jennifer is part of my ACFW (American Christian Fiction Writers) chapter, I couldn’t remember if we’d actually met before ( #Becausethatplaguewhichshallnotbenamed ), but then Jennifer reminded me of a jaunt through Fullerton, California from Hope International University to a yogurt shop where I had some amazing blueberry lavender yogurt (and became obsessed with making it myself.  Let’s just say it’s amazing and leave it at that.

That’s when I recalled that I liked her in person, too.  Always a blessing.  I just didn’t know what kind of books she wrote but now…

It’s my favorite thing authors do, and when they do it right and find a different take on it, the books come alive in super cool ways.  What is it?

Spin-offs.  “What’s so brilliant about that?” you ask? “Don’t lots of authors do spin-offs? Haven’t you done spin-offs?” The answers are, in order: lots, yes, and yes.  But in her spin-off from her Hometown Heroes series, J.L. Crosswhite is particularly clever.  She looked at what makes a hero, how folks react to those heroes, and then dug deep and found a nugget.

Heroes often have siblings, friends, someone who lives in their shadows. What happens when their lives become stories that keep you on the edge of your seat?  Jennifer explores that.

Over Her Head J.L. CrosswhiteAbout Over Her Head by J .L. Crosswhite

She’s working on a new start…

…He’s better with computers than people.

Can they build a relationship that fits their new life?

Fresh-out-of-cosmetology-school Jessica and whiz-software-engineer Austin have been thrown together by mutual friends. They even escaped a wildfire together.

But do they have something more than friendship?

Maybe a singles’ camping trip will make their future clear.

When they encounter someone who needs their help, the relaxing weekend away becomes anything but. As the danger mounts and the challenges reveal who they truly are, will it pull them together or push them apart… for good?

You will get lost in Over Her Head because the biggest adventure is falling in love.

A Riddle in the Lonesome October by JPC Allen

How do you survive a season of fear? October is a hard month for Rae Riley’s family. Her dad, Sheriff Walter “Mal” Malinowski lost his wife and father then. He also has to manage the trouble Halloween brings to rural Marlin County, Ohio. But this year, Rae’s uncle fights for his life after a riding accident, and a family feud over a lost inheritance erupts at a local Halloween attraction. As Rae tries to support her family, she and her cousin Amber work to unravel the 70-year-old riddle that will reveal the location of the inheritance so their great aunt Lily and her kids can gain a fortune. And Rae must deal with the secretive behavior of the deputy she’s fallen for. When a bogus medium conducts a séance to contact Cyrus Morley, the man who devised the riddle, the results stun everyone, and the aftermath is even more shocking. There’s only one way to survive a season of so much fear–and only one way to unmask a killer.
